Urges the Department of Education to study the cost and benefits of hiring mental health professionals for public schools and creating telehealth.
The bill urges the Department of Education, in consultation with the Department of Health, to conduct a study on the cost and benefits of hiring mental health professionals for every public school in Hawaii. It also examines the benefits of creating guidelines for establishing safe spaces for students to access telehealth services during school hours. The study aims to address the growing mental health crisis among youth, particularly the shortage of mental health professionals and the decline in telehealth service use.
